Транслятор с С# кода в код ассемблера х86 [требует правки]

279
18 июня 2017, 14:56

В универе поставили задачу написать транслятор с С# языка на язык ассемблера(x86). Честно говоря ниразу в жизни даже не трогал ассемблер, а уже тем более не пытался писать на него транслятор. Как я понял моя прога должна получать на вход некоторый шарп код и показывать мне вариацию ассемблер кода. Мне казалось, что я смогу сделать это легко с помощью CodeDOM или Microsoft.CodeAnalysis(Roslyn) средствами генерации, а там не все так просто походу. В общем, если кто делал уже подобное, объясните вообще какие технологии гуглить, в каком направлении изучать этот вопрос.

READ ALSO
Поиск по стороннему сайту на C#

Поиск по стороннему сайту на C#

Реально ли организовать поиск по стороннему, не своему, сайту по ключевым словам? Нужно искать соответствующие страницы, дальнейший парсинг...

251
Распарсить XML-файл с помощью c#

Распарсить XML-файл с помощью c#

ЗдравствуйтеУ меня в проекте ASP

371
C# string.Compare

C# string.Compare

при сравнении данным методом "а" строковой и "В", будет ли метод использовать код символов в юникод? У а – 97, у В – 66Значит если сравнить их без...

244
Пусть разработчика с чего начать? [требует правки]

Пусть разработчика с чего начать? [требует правки]

Добрый вечер, друзьяЗадаю данный вопрос не для поднятия холиваров, хочу выяснить для себя с чего начать

245